Mikel Oyarzabal proved Spain’s hero within the Euro 2024 last, sealing a job properly completed for the La Roja substitute in opposition to England.

Actual Sociedad’s Oyarzabal scored with 4 minutes remaining after approaching as a second-half substitute, serving to Luis de la Fuente’s crew to their fourth European Championship crown.

That’s greater than every other nation has managed within the competitors’s 64-year historical past as Spain have been indebted to Oyarzabal’s deft end from Marc Cucurella’s left-wing supply.

The 27-year-old refused to take the approval for his heroics in opposition to Gareth Southgate’s aspect, nonetheless.

“I’ve completed my job. I did what I needed to do at each second to attempt to assist,” Spain’s match-winner advised reporters after Sunday’s 2-1 win.

“I used to be fortunate sufficient to present the victory. Simply the very fact of being within the 27, you worth it lots right here. To have the second to assist because it has occurred to me is one of the best.

“It occurred to me however might have occurred to anybody.”

Nico Williams had earlier opened the scoring after the interval earlier than substitute Cole Palmer levelled to tee up a tantalising finale.

Williams, aged 22 years and two days, turned the second youngest participant to attain in a Euros last, behind solely Pietro Anastasi in 1968 for Italy (20 years, 64 days).

His end, simply 69 seconds within the second half, was additionally the earliest second-half aim scored in a European Championship showpiece.
